A self-proclaimed godman has allegedly duped more than 30 US cities into entering a cultural partnership agreement with a fictional country, called the United States of Kailasa (USK). The City of Newark entered a sister city agreement with USK this year at a signing ceremony hosted at the City Hall. The official website of USK reports other major US cities, including Dayton, Ohio; Richmond, Virginia; and Buena Park, Florida to have entered into a pact with USK. Reports also indicate that at least three members of the Congress recognize USK as a real country. Representatives Troy Balderson, David Valadao, and Norma Torres might have awarded a ‘special congressional recognition’ to USK. Representatives from Kailasa were also seen attending a United Nations meeting in Geneva.

Apparently, USK is a country off the coast of Ecuador. However, the Ecuadorian government had clarified that Nithyananda has not been granted asylum. His passport had been canceled by the Indian government, besides rejecting the application for a new document. The Indian foreign ministry had instructed all missions abroad to locate Nithyananda. The City of Newark rescinded the sister city agreement after realizing the circumstances. The UN human rights office has stated that submissions made by representatives of USK are ‘irrelevant,’ and have no place in the final outcome drafts of its Geneva conference.

Nithyananda is wanted on charges of rape and abduction in India. The Interpol had issued a Blue Corner notice on the international fugitive. The official Twitter of Nithyananda remains active. The so-called supreme pontiff of Hinduism recently congratulated Xi Jinping after he was re-elected as the President of China. As the Newark incident became public, the Twitter handle blamed ‘Hinduphobia and racism in the media.’ In addition, the statement also accused the media of spreading ‘disinformation, hate speech, and religious shaming.’
